How to Use BARB0BAMUND for Money Transfers

The IFSC code BARB0BAMUND is specifically assigned to the BAMUNDIHA, WEST BENGAL branch of Bank of Baroda located in PURULIYA, WEST BENGAL. This unique code is mandatory for routing electronic payments correctly within India.

NEFT Transfer

Use BARB0BAMUND when adding this branch as a beneficiary in NEFT transactions. NEFT operates in half-hourly batches from 12:30 AM to 12:00 AM on all days. Enter the IFSC, account number, and account holder name carefully to ensure successful transfer.

RTGS Transfer

For high-value transactions above ₹2 lakh, RTGS offers real-time gross settlement. Use BARB0BAMUND along with the beneficiary's exact account number. RTGS is available on working days from 7:00 AM to 6:00 PM.

IMPS & UPI

IMPS and UPI allow instant 24×7 transfers. While UPI apps often auto-resolve the IFSC from the VPA, mobile banking apps require BARB0BAMUND when registering a new beneficiary.

Always double-check the account number before confirming any transfer — the IFSC routes funds to the correct branch, but the account number specifies the exact recipient.
